    TristanD79 reacted to Seyrren in Upgrading from Windows 7 Pro to Windows 10? Do I keep the same version, i.e. Windows 10 Pro??   
    For Basic and Home versions of windows 7 you upgrade to Windows 10 Home, for Professional and Ultimate versions you get Windows 10 Pro.

    TristanD79 reacted to DigitalGoat in Upgrading from Windows 7 Pro to Windows 10? Do I keep the same version, i.e. Windows 10 Pro??   
    You should get the same version you had before upgrading. Ideally use an app like Macrium Free to image your Win7 disk, then upgrade your current Win7 install to Windows 10, once the upgraded install has activated you will then have a digital license for Win10 on that PC. You can then clean install Win10 if you want.
